How To Choose a Pest Control Company

Pest control businesses aren't all identical when it comes to reputation, expertise, and effectiveness. It’s important to research businesses to find the right one for your specific situation. Focus on these key factors when hiring a pest control provider:

Services Offered

You should choose a pest control company that is equipped to handle your specific problem, whether it's termites, bed bugs, roaches, rodents, or something else. The company should have clearly laid out its expertise with your specific pest.

Expertise

The ideal pest management provider will employ technicians that have state licenses and are certified in pest control methods by associations like the National Pest Management Association (NPMA). These credentials show that the technicians have received proper training. You'll also want to inquire with each company about regular education updates for their employees.

Experience and Reputation

Spend time perusing online reviews on Google and Yelp before scheduling a pest control appointment. This can help you confirm whether the company consistently provides quality service and positive experiences. Also check the Better Business Bureau for any complaints. Ask the provider whether technicians receive ongoing regular training to stay current on the latest pest control methods. When you choose a provider from our list of Tucson's best pest control, you can rest easy knowing you're hiring an expert that meets our quality and review standards.

Green Pest Control

If you prefer natural pest control methods, look for providers that advertise “green” certifications. For bigger animals such as mice or squirrels, ask if a provider offers gentle catch and release programs. Bear in mind natural options may not work as well for significant infestations. If you have a moderate to serious pest problem, you may need more potent traditional solutions. Regardless of what methods you choose, any pesticides (besides those classified as minimal risk) are required to be registered with the EPA.

Reservice Guarantee

Leading pest control professionals typically offer service guarantees for ongoing plans. This means that if pests remain after the initial treatment, the company will come back and re-treat your home for free until the infestation is eliminated. One-time treatments might not come with reservice guarantees.

Questions To Ask Pest Control Companies

After choosing your top exterminators, call each one and ask questions such as these:

  • What results can I realistically expect after the initial and follow-up visits? The company should set clear expectations about pest eradication timelines and benchmarks.
  • How soon can you start treatment or service at my property? It's important to begin the process ASAP before the infestation grows.
  • How often will you provide ongoing care after the first visit? Many companies provide monthly, quarterly, or yearly service programs to help prevent infestations from returning.
  • Can you provide a complete cost analysis and service plan in writing upfront? This lets you get an idea of pest control costs and avoid companies with unclear conditions or hidden fees.
  • What pest control products and treatments does your company use? Make sure the approaches meet your needs for typical chemical treatments versus eco-friendly or green options. Get details about the chemicals that the company will use.

Assess potential pest control companies based on their answers to these questions. This will allow you to select the best provider to effectively address your pest problem at a reasonable cost.

In a big city like Tucson, where the cost of living is above average compared to other cities, the cost of pest control is most likely a concern. The cost of pest control depends on several factors, such as what kind of pests are troubling you and how bad the infestation is. A single visit can cost between $300 and $500, while a quarterly treatment plan is generally cheaper — around $100 to $300 a visit.

Spring is the best time for proactive pest control. The reason is nests and colony numbers will get much higher when it's hotter, so spraying in the spring can help prevent you from getting too many pests later.
